Google Earth Evolves: Time Travel, AI Insights, and the Future of Exploration

Google’s recent update to Google Earth, bringing historical Street View imagery and AI-driven insights, signals a fascinating direction for how we explore our planet. This isn’t just about reliving memories; it’s about understanding our world’s evolution and making smarter decisions for the future.

Unveiling the Past: The Power of Historical Imagery

The ability to revisit Street View imagery from different points in time is a game-changer. Before, users were limited to accessing these time capsules on Google Maps. Now, within Google Earth itself, users can virtually time travel, allowing them to see how places have changed over time. This feature, which capitalizes on a trend that blossomed on social media, provides invaluable context.

This isn’t just about nostalgia. Think about the urban planner examining the evolution of a city block, the historian tracing architectural changes, or the homeowner assessing how a neighborhood has developed. The implications are far-reaching.

Did you know? Google Earth’s initial launch in 2005 saw 100 million downloads within its first week, a testament to its instant popularity. In the past year alone, people have searched for places in Google Earth more than 2 billion times!

AI-Powered Insights: Shaping a Smarter Tomorrow

Beyond time travel, Google is leveraging AI to provide deeper, more actionable insights. In the U.S., professional users can now access AI-driven data, such as tree canopy coverage and land surface temperature, for cities.

For example, in Austin, Texas, users can pinpoint areas with limited tree cover, informing strategies for urban cooling and sustainability. Access to land surface temperature data helps urban planners make more informed decisions. This moves beyond passive observation; it allows proactive, data-driven decision-making.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How do I access historical Street View imagery on Google Earth?
A: Simply navigate to a location in Google Earth and look for the clock icon, indicating historical imagery is available.

Q: What types of AI-driven insights are available?
A: Currently, professional users in the U.S. can access tree canopy coverage and land surface temperature data.

Decoding the Depths: China’s Strategic Submarine Advances

Recent satellite imagery updates from Google Earth have unveiled intriguing insights into China’s naval capabilities: a fleet of six nuclear submarines stationed at Qingdao’s Naval Base. This revelation not only highlights China’s advancing maritime prowess but also draws attention to global naval dynamics.

The Significance of Satellite Imagery

Satellite imagery, a tool for civilian curiosity and strategic analysis, sheds light on areas often shrouded in secrecy. While some military installations remain off-limits to such surveillance, the visibility of China’s submarine fleet underscores shifts in naval transparency and strategic posturing.

IFL Science reports indicate that China’s estimated 600 nuclear warheads, though dwarfed by the U.S. arsenal, are formidable enough to pose significant geopolitical threats. This scenario merits a deeper dive into China’s naval strategy.

China’s Naval Doctrine: An Evolving Landscape

China’s naval strategy has traditionally centered around its principle of non-first use of nuclear weapons, relying heavily on land-based and aerial nuclear forces. However, recent developments reveal a growing focus on bolstering its undersea deterrent capabilities.

The People’s Liberation Army Navy (PLAN) is undergoing a significant modernization drive aimed at increasing its fleet of nuclear-powered and diesel-electric submarines. This strategy augments China’s ability to project power and maintain second-strike capabilities.

Trends in Strategic Upkeep and Expansion

China’s continuous expansion of its submarine force points to a broader trend of militarization beneath the waves. As reported by the Nuclear Threat Initiative, this effort is set to see the PLAN expand to 65 submarines by 2025.

This maritime expansion reflects China’s commitment to augmenting its defensive and offensive capabilities in a multipolar world.

Global Implications and Strategic Balance

The recalibration of naval forces has global implications, potentially altering the strategic balance in regions like the Asia-Pacific. Such enhancements could compel neighboring countries and global superpowers to reassess their maritime strategies and alliances.

FAQs: Understanding Submarine Advancements

What is the strategic purpose of nuclear submarines?

Nuclear submarines serve as stealthy platforms for nuclear deterrence. Their ability to remain submerged for extended periods makes them formidable assets in a nation’s defense arsenal.

How do submarine fleets influence global military strategy?

Submarine fleets enhance undersea warfare capabilities, enabling nations to protect strategic assets and execute covert operations. Their presence often deters adversarial actions and maintains geopolitical stability.
